South Jersey Group 4
(1) Southern 16, (8) Lenape 2
Junior midfielder Kyle Sininsky registered four goals and three assists, as the Rams (16-5) cruised past the Indians (11-8). Junior attacker Cash McVey finished with four goals and an assist. Junior attacker Gavin Nascimento tallied a career-high six points on three goals and three assists. Junior attacker Shea O’Donnell added three goals and two assists. Sophomore midfielder Cole Celeste added a goal and an assist. Junior midfielder Jack Ramsey scored a goal. Sophomore midfielder Niko Iliescu recorded three assists. Senior FOGO Vinnie Ruta dominated possession, winning 21-of-23 face-offs. Junior goalie Nick Hughes made four saves, while sophomore goalie Gunnar Hanzl made three saves.
Southern will host (4) Cherokee in the semifinals.

North Jersey Group 2
(3) Holmdel 12, (6) Montville 7
Senior midfielder Jack Cannon registered a career-high nine points on three goals and a career-high six assists, as the Hornets (16-5) defeated the Mustangs (14-6). Junior attacker David Perrotti finished with three goals and an assist. Senior LSM Marcus Cermele and sophomore midfielder Anthony Serini each scored two goals. Senior attacker Finnegan Buchan added a goal and an assist. Junior attacker James Esposito also scored a goal. Senior goalie Jack Tiller made seven saves.
Holmdel will travel to (2) Sparta in the semifinals.
South Jersey Group 2
(1) Ocean City 15, (8) Barnegat 0
Junior Otter Donohue registered four goals and two assists, and junior goalie Timmy Windfelder recorded nine saves, as the Red Raiders (14-6) eliminated the Bengals (8-13).
Barnegat will graduate 10 seniors including midfielder Keegan Dunn who recorded 206 career points, FOGO Eric Connors who won 60% of his face-offs during his career, and goalie DJ Swierk who recorded his 500th career save in the loss.
(2) Manasquan 17, (10) Sterling 4
Senior midfielder Jack O’Reilly registered three goals and three assists, as the Warriors (11-6) dominated the Silver Knights (16-4), jumping out to an 8-0 lead at the end of the first quarter and never looking back. Junior midfielder Dax Klein tallied three goals and an assist. Juniors Mason Schlaefer, Kieran Schneider, and sophomore Casey Mahoney each finished with two goals and two assists. Freshman attacker Reilly Malone scored a career-high two goals. Sophomore Johnny Kumpf added a goal and an assist. Senior midfielder Dylan Lu and freshman attacker Myles Byrne each tallied a goal. Junior goalie MJ Femenella made five saves. Senior goalies Thomas Bovitz and Thomas Canning each made three saves.
Manasquan will host (3) Robbinsville in the semifinals. The Warriors defeated the Ravens 10-3 on opening day.
(5) Allentown 7, (4) Wall 6 (OT)
Senior Brian McCaffrey won 16-0f-17 faceoffs and scored a game-high four goals, as the Redbirds (14-7) eliminated the Crimson Knights (8-12).
Senior midfielder Patrick Freud registered two goals and an assist in the loss. Sophomore attacker Declan Freud added two goals. Sophomore midfielder Luke Harmon and freshman attacker Reid Wehner each added a goal. Senior attacker Wyatt Capro, senior FOGO Dylan Cohen, and sophomore defender Brady Kurth each recorded an assist. Junior goalie Ethan Buckley made 11 saves.
Wall will graduate an impactful group of five seniors including Freud, Capro, Cohen, defender Justin Davis, and midfielder Liam Lomerson. Freud finished his career with 199 total points, while Capro compiled 175 points.
The Crimson Knights will return a host of underclassmen talent, including rising sophomore scoring duo Nolan Larkin and Reid Wehner.
